Spoon Champs! Each week our cooks are looking for a different character trait from our students while they are having lunch. Students are unaware of what character trait they are monitoring until the end of the week so we are seeing improvements all around. Last week's secret character trait was manners, and the silver spoon went to the third grade class. Congrats to our THIRD GRADERS!
